A short story (StarWars Universe) starts some time before the 4th
movie. An AI battle/assassin droid being built in a secret Imperial
factory becomes in self aware, kills its makers, it makes several
copies of its brain before destroying the factory removing all traces
of its existence. One infects factories making new droids. The new
droids become sleeper agents of the revolution waiting for a signal to
go on their killing spree. One of the copies is the droid bounty
hunter seen in Episode 5, it was latter destroyed. Another was just
about to be installed in the second Death Star when it was blown up.
Some similar fate meets all the rest of the copies and so the Droid
rebellion failed because there existed no one to give the command.
But what if one survived.
